首页 | 本学科首页   官方微博 | 高级检索  
     

片上系统设计中软硬件协同验证方法的研究
引用本文:严迎建,刘明业.片上系统设计中软硬件协同验证方法的研究[J].电子与信息学报,2005,27(2):317-321.
作者姓名:严迎建  刘明业
作者单位:北京理工大学ASIC研究所,北京,100081;信息工程大学电子技术学院,郑州,450004;北京理工大学ASIC研究所,北京,100081
摘    要:讨论一种面向片上系统(SOC)设计的基于指令集模拟器和硬件模拟器的软硬件协同验证方法。该方法能够在SOC设计的早期对整个系统功能进行验证,能够为设计者提供一个纯虚拟的软硬件协同验证环境。重点讨论协同模拟过程中软硬件交互事件的产生和处理方法,以及软硬件模拟器之间的同步和优化方法,并且给出了事件驱动硬件模拟器的协同模拟控制算法。最后给出了一个基于ARM7TDMI的设计验证实例。

关 键 词:片上系统    协同验证    协同模拟    指令集模拟器
文章编号:1009-5896(2005)02-0317-05
收稿时间:2003-8-25
修稿时间:2003年8月25日

A Hardware-Software Co-verification Method for SOC Design
Yan Ying-jian,Liu Ming-ye.A Hardware-Software Co-verification Method for SOC Design[J].Journal of Electronics & Information Technology,2005,27(2):317-321.
Authors:Yan Ying-jian  Liu Ming-ye
Affiliation:ASIC Research Center Beijing Institute of Technology Beijing 100081 China;College of Electronic Technology Info. Eng. University Zhengzhou 450004 China
Abstract:This paper presents a hardware-software co-verification method for SOC design, which is based on instruction set simulator and hardware simulator, and used to validate function of SOC in the early design phase. The generating and processing methods of interactive events between hardware and software simulator during co-simulation are discussed in detail. An algorithm of synchronizing between hardware and software simulator is presented, and to reduce the synchronization overhead, some optimizing methods are introduced. Finally, an co-verification example of a design based on ARM7TDMI is given.
Keywords:System-on- chip  Co-verification  Co-simulation  Instruction set simulator
本文献已被 CNKI 维普 万方数据 等数据库收录!
点击此处可从《电子与信息学报》浏览原始摘要信息
点击此处可从《电子与信息学报》下载全文
设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号